Direct cash transfer for LPG consumers starts today New Delhi: Direct transfer scheme for LPG cylinder subsidy has come into force from June 1. Under the scheme, the government will transfer Rs 435 directly in the bank accounts of LPG consumers in 18 districts of the country.

Consumers will get the money each time they book for an LPG refill. These consumers then will have to buy cooking gas at market price. The government hopes to save Rs 8,000-10,000 crore annually after the scheme is rolled out all over the country.

The government intends to extend the scheme to rest of the country before end of the year but wants to see results in the 18 districts first. The districts selected have high Aadhaar or unique identification number penetration.

While as many as 89 per cent of the LPG consuming population in these districts have Aadhaar number, the government will give a three-month grace period to them to procure the UID number and seed it with their bank accounts where cash subsidy has to be transferred....more

Jharkhand: Aadhaar mandatory for sale, purchase of land Ranchi: Aadhaar will be mandatory as proof during land deals in Jharkhand from January 1 2014, an official release said on Tuesday. The decision was taken to bring in transparency in the sale/purchase of land and prevention of registering the same land more than once, the release said quoting Chief Secretary RS Sharma. Govt approves Rs 3,436 cr for Phase IV of Aadhaar scheme New Delhi: The government on Thursday approved Rs 3,436.16 crore for Phase IV of the UID (Aadhaar card) scheme, which will commence immediately. The decision to approve Phase IV of the UID project at the cost of Rs 3,436.16 crore was taken in New Delhi at a meeting of the Cabinet Committee on Unique Identification Authority of India (CC-UIDAI), an official statement said. Aadhaar card enrolment 99 per cent in Chandigarh Chandigarh: The enrolment for Aadhaar card has touched 99 per cent and 88.6 per cent in Union Territory of Chandigarh and Himachal Pradesh respectively. The enrolment figure under the Unique Identification Authority of India (UIDAI) scheme in Punjab and Haryana is 62.9 per cent and 30.1 per cent respectively so far, Keshni Anand Arora, UIDAI, Deputy Director General (Northern Region), said. Over 8000 eunuchs received Aadhaar numbers in 2012 8,805 eunuchs living across the country were issued Aadhaar numbers in 2012 by the Unique Identification Authority of India (UIDAI). Only 96 Aadhaar numbers were issued to eunuchs in 2010. ...
